Output 1dd91a2f240c849ad642c2149b33fe83039be8d686c2dd31b37eaf98d3faac14: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95cdab0635b39be2e1d6f4a1368d3fd7b58cbaa5 OP_EQUAL
address
3FM6zCD59TRmxsbsuhygWUrQFMyhC5vDhg
transaction
1dd91a2f240c849ad642c2149b33fe83039be8d686c2dd31b37eaf98d3faac14
spent
true